Tea for One

16/04/2024 C and K Words3 Comments

A cup of tea, for one; I sit alone with my archived thoughts.

A welcomed cup of tea, yet the thoughts are wicked and sorrowful.

Can’t we brush them away? If we did, then I wouldn’t be thinking about you.

I used to long for days alone. Now they are my everyday.

The Imagined Sea

14/04/202417/08/2025 C and K WordsLeave a comment

Standing sideways to what was once the sea
imaginary wavelets lap at my dirt-covered feet

Sedimentary rocks hide traces of crustaceans
the breeze moves the trees, & stirs the unseen

Saltwater jewels adorn my ears, wrists, & neck
imaginary saltwater washes over me, the land

Blooming Reverie

13/04/202417/08/2025 C and K Words2 Comments

A warm breeze moves through
the garden and the blooming trees.

Hair becomes waves of the sea,
cloth caressing skin becomes caged wings.

A Crow visits her favourite tree
with a plastic milk bottle lid for kindness.

Lost within the romance of Spring,
drifting away.

By Andrew Butko

Slowing Down

25/03/202426/03/2024 C and K WordsLeave a comment

We begin to slow in Autumn as the days shorten and the nights lengthen.

Salads turn to casseroles, and coffee turns to rum.

We find our cosy corner, a stack of books, and turn day after day into night.

When the rains come, we wear our favourite socks; we slow down.

Noodle Warrior

24/03/202418/03/2024 C and K WordsLeave a comment

A mighty warrior
traveller of many lands
A lover of noodles

Ramen and sake
cantankerous words and dancing
A Geisha’s fan cuts

Angered at the offence
drawing his sword
The laughter of Geishas

A 30-centimeter sword
hardly Arthurian
Perfect for cutting noodles
